Articles must be submitted in French. The Editorial Committee reserves the right to accept articles written in other languages by non-French-speaking authors.
Presentation of articles:

The first page of the article proposal should include the names of the authors and the contact details (address, telephone and fax) of the author to whom all correspondence should be sent. It should include titles and abstracts in French and English. Submissions are not required to comply with the journal's (other) layout standards, but if they do, authors undertake to convert their article to these standards for publication.
Layout standards: Settings in various versions of Word.
- Title page: Authors' names; abstracts, titles and keywords must appear in French and English. (Maximum 150-word abstract and a maximum of six keywords).
- Body text as described below:
- Document format 17 x 24: Width: 17; height: 24
- Margins: top, bottom, left right: 2 cm
- Font: Arial 10, Arial 12 for titles Single-spaced
- Paragraphs: right- and left-justified
- Text structure: bold headings (e.g. 1.); bold subheadings (e.g. 1.1).
- Text from 30,000 to 75,000 characters (10 to 25 pages excluding bibliography)
- Conclusion: show the applicability of the concepts developed

Editorial policy:
- The editorial board reserves the right to reject any article, without peer review, that does not correspond to the journal's purpose. Selected articles are double-blind evaluated by members of the scientific committee and/or a professional involved in the topic. The reviewers' comments are forwarded to the authors. Articles will only be accepted for publication if they take account of the reviewers' comments. Any article submitted by an author automatically implies his or her agreement to publication in VSE in both paper and digital editions.
- The author(s) certify(s) that the proposed article is the fruit of individual or collective work, and that the sources used are explicitly referenced in the biographical notes appended to the article. The author(s) certify(s) that the article presented has not been submitted or will not be submitted in its current form to other publishers.
Proofs :
- Final proofs will be sent to the corresponding author for correction. The author must return the proofs within 15 days of receipt, to avoid any delay in printing.
